GAUGE
In St st, using U.S. size 7 (4.5mm) needles, 20 sts and 28 rows = 4"/10cm
STITCHES USED
K1, p1 rib
Stockinette stitch (St st)
Bead Stitch: Bring yarn to front, slide bead up to needle, slip next stitch purlwise, bring yarn to back, tighten yarn before working next stitch.
PATTERN STITCH
Bead Pattern (worked over 5 sts):
Row 1 (RS): K2, bead st, k2.
Rows 2, 4 and 6 (WS): Purl.
Row 3: K1, bead st, k1, bead st, k1.
Row 5: Rep Row 1.
Row 7: Knit.
Row 8: Purl.
Rep Rows 1–8 for patt.
SPECIAL TERM
k1-f/b: Knit 1 front and back – Knit next st, then knit it through the back loop. (1 st increased)
NOTES
Wristlets are worked on two needles. The thumb stitches are added to each side and joined by a seam.
The bead pattern is worked over five marked stitches.
The beads must be large enough to thread the yarn through.
Thread the beads before starting project using a dental floss threader or any beading needle.
LEFT GLOVELET
Thread 16 beads onto yarn.
With larger needles, CO 34 sts.
Change to smaller needles Work in k1, p1 rib for 12 rows. Change to larger needles.
Next row (RS): K across inc 4 sts evenly spaced—38 sts.
Next row: Purl.
Beginning patt:
Row 1 (RS): K7, pm (place marker), work Row 1 of bead patt on next 5 sts, pm, k to end of row.
Rows 2, 4 and 6 (WS): Purl.
Row 3: K7, sm (slip marker), work Row 3 of bead patt on next 5 sts, sm, k to end.
Row 5: Rep Row 1.
Row 7: Knit.
Row 8: Purl.
Thumb Gusset:
Row 1 (RS): K1, k1-f/b, k1, pm, k4, work Row 1 of bead patt on next 5 sts, k to last 3 sts, pm, k1, k1-f/b, k1—40 sts.
Rows 2, 4 and 6: Purl.
Row 3: K2, k1-f/b, k1, sm, k4, work Row 3 of bead patt on next 5 sts, k to next marker, sm, k1, k1-f/b, k2—42 sts.
Row 5: K3, k1-f/b, k1, sm, k4, work Row 5 of bead patt on next 5 sts, k to next marker, sm, k1, k1-f/b, k3—44 sts.
Row 7: K across row, k1-f/b in st 2 sts before first marker and in 2nd st after second marker—46 sts.
Row 8: Purl across row.
Continue in est patt repeating incs and bead patt until there are 52 sts.
BO 7 sts at beg of next 2 rows to end thumb—38 sts.
Rep Beginning Patt Rows 1–8 once more.
Change to smaller needles. Work in k1, p1 rib for 4 more rows. BO in rib.
RIGHT GLOVELET
Work as for Left Glovelet, reversing for thumb placement.
FINISHING
Using yarn needle, weave in ends. Sew side seam.
